Boosting Productivity: Strategies for a Successful Home Office

To maximize productivity in your home office, consider implementing these effective strategies. First and foremost establishing a dedicated workspace that is free from distractions and promotes focus. A well-organized environment with clear boundaries between work and personal life can significantly boost your overall efficiency.

To greatly enhance productivity, it's crucial to establish a structured schedule. Set aside specific times for tasks, meetings, and breaks to maintain rhythm throughout the day. This can help you keep on track and avoid feeling overwhelmed.

Remember to incorporate regular breaks to prevent burnout and recharge. Moving around for a few minutes can help revive your mind and improve your focus when you return to work.

Finally, don't fear to leverage technology to your advantage. There are numerous resources available that can help with task management, communication, and time tracking.

Setting Boundaries: Protecting Your Personal Time in a Home-Based Business

Working from home can be an amazing perk, offering flexibility and comfort. However, it also presents unique challenges when it comes to dividing work life from personal time. Without clear boundaries, you risk burning.

It's vital to create boundaries that preserve your personal time and energy. This means designating specific work hours, creating a dedicated workspace, and informing these limits with clients and family.

By putting into action these strategies, you can enjoy the benefits of a home-based business while preserving your work-life balance.
